package hdf.hdf5lib.callbacks;
/**
* Information class for link callback for H5Pset/get_append_flush.
*
*/
public interface H5D_append_cb extends Callbacks {
/**
* application callback for each dataset access property list
*
* @param dataset_id the ID for the dataset being iterated over
* @param cur_dims the dimension sizes for determining boundary
* @param op_data the operator data passed in to H5Pset/get_append_flush
*
* @return operation status
* A. Zero causes the iterator to continue, returning zero when all
* attributes have been processed.
* B. Positive causes the iterator to immediately return that positive
* value, indicating short-circuit success. The iterator can be
* restarted at the next attribute.
* C. Negative causes the iterator to immediately return that value,
* indicating failure. The iterator can be restarted at the next
* attribute.
*/
int callback(long dataset_id, long[] cur_dims, H5D_append_t op_data);
}
